Email marketing spend 'will continue to soar'

Wednesday 26th November 2008

Although online advertising growth is likely to slow over the next year, the amount spent on email marketing is likely to continue rising, it is claimed.

Predictions made by analysts Collins Stewart suggest the amount spent on online marketing will increase by 10.9 per cent next year and 14.7 per cent in 2010.

This is a downwards revision on the company's original predictions which suggested growth would be almost 20 per cent next year and over 20 per cent in 2010.

However, it asserts email marketing growth will continue strong.

"We believe search, lead generation, email marketing and online video advertising will likely [lead to] growth above [the] industry average," the company continues.

Government support organisation Business Link says email marketing can be "a powerful and flexible form of direct marketing".
